Do Follow Blog, Comment Luv, Keyword Luv, Top Commentator
Like most savvy bloggers today, I offer “follow” links for your site by running top commenter, comment luv and keyword luv, which allows me to reward follow links for quality comments without back links.
In order to receive a follow link you must provide quality comments. Low quality comments are things like – great site, keep up the good work, can’t wait to learn more – and really add nothing to the issue being discussed.
Quality links add to the conversation, engage someone to respond to you and provide others with an opportunity to know more about something you have knowledge on. Share an experience, give someone some advice, ask some questions and you will have added quality content to this site and receive your follow link.
I expect some commenters will not read this post, so they won’t even know their low quality comments will be deleted. So, in order to get a link, stay on topic, and add to the original post. Follow these simple guidelines and you will be rewarded with a follow link that have been proven to give your own blog or site juice.
